How to grow succulents

1. Suitable soil

First of all, to grow succulents, it is best to use fertile, well-breathable soil, and avoid using soil that is too sticky. In addition, the soil must have good drainage. If the drainage is poor, water accumulation will easily occur. If the roots of the plants are soaked in water for a long time, it will cause root rot.

2. Reasonable lighting

Succulent plants should be given sufficient light during their growth period and should not be kept in a dark environment for a long time. If the growing environment is too dark, the plant will grow too tall. However, appropriate shading measures need to be taken when maintaining the plant outdoors in summer, and the plant should be avoided from prolonged exposure to strong sunlight. If it is maintained indoors, it is best to place it on a sunny balcony or windowsill so that it can receive sufficient light in spring, autumn and winter.

3. Watering in moderation

If you want succulents to grow better, you need to water them appropriately. There should be no accumulation of water in the potting soil after watering. If there is water accumulation for a long time, its roots will rot. When it is actively growing, it needs to be watered in time to avoid the leaves from drying out. It will enter a dormant state in summer. In addition to normal watering, you should also spray the plant with water more often to keep the soil in the pot moist.

4. Suitable temperature

The temperature suitable for the growth of succulents is between 12-28℃, and spring and autumn are its peak growth seasons. The temperature is relatively low in winter, so it needs to be adjusted appropriately. It is best to keep the temperature above 8°C. The temperature in summer should not exceed 35℃. If the temperature is too high, certain cooling measures need to be taken and proper ventilation must be ensured.
